What to check before for pre-war buildings near the 2 train in the Bronx

  • Confirm the exact cross streets and walking time to the 2 train for each building, since “near the 2” can vary by block.
  • Ask how the building handles older-system maintenance (heat/hot water, plumbing, elevators, vermin prevention) and get the answers in writing.
  • Check current monthly costs beyond rent (broker fee, security/deposit, and any required move-in fees) before you apply.
  • If you’re sensitive to noise or vibration, schedule a viewing at the time you plan to spend most at home and compare units on different floors.
  • Use tenant Q&A and review context to spot recurring issues early, then verify them directly with the management team.
